When we buy SAF it is added into the existing fuel pipeline at strategic locations with such SAF having been blended with conventional fossil fuel before it reaches the aircraft. Using SAF results in a reduction in carbon emissions compared to the traditional jet fuel it replaces over the lifecycle of the fuel and can drop straight into existing fuel supply infrastructure and aircraft. British Airways, LanzaJet and Nova Pangaea Technologies signed an agreement in November 2022 that will accelerate Project Speedbird, an initiative created by the companies in 2021 to develop cost-effective SAF for commercial use in the UK. The independently certified carbon removal projects available on the platform include the Blue Carbon Mangrove Project, a nature-based project which will support the reforestation and revegetation of degraded tidal wetlands in the Indus Delta Area in Pakistan and the Freres Biocharproject in Oregon, USA, which sees the companys biomass power production plant produce biochar, a carbon-rich charcoal-like material that is created when agricultural and wood waste is used as fuel. In 2022, a new Group-wide Whistleblowing Policy was issued and all the Group channels to enable this were consolidated to one whistleblowing channel provided by an independent third-party provider, EthicsPoint, where concerns can be raised on an anonymous and confidential basis.
